Have you heard of SWATting? It's pretty terrifying, actually. The person making the threats of doxxing can call the victim's local police department (or have someone else do it) and leave an anonymous "tip" saying that she's doing something terrible so that a swat team shows up. There are clips of it happening to streamers on YouTube if you want to get an idea of what happens.

It can be very traumatic, especially in a country like the US. It can also be lethal, and rope in people who are completely innocent.

To OP: please encourage your friend to contact her local police. This could help prevent the above from happening, and it also starts a paper trail in case other shit happens in the future. If everything goes right, they might even be able to press charges against the individual harassing her.

Personally, I would also strongly recommend she lets her parents/guardians know about what's happening too. It won't be a fun conversation for her, but it could help keep everyone safe.

Here are some questions you can ask yourself that might help you determine if you're trans.

  1. Do you experience any gender dysphoria? For example, do you dislike or hate your breasts, facial features, or other feminine characteristics?
  2. Does the idea of taking opposite sex hormones make you happy?
  3. If you imagine yourself as a man or nonbinary person (agender, demiboy/girl, genderfluid, genderqueer, etc) does that bring you happiness and/or gender euphoria?

If you answered yes or even maybe to any of these questions, you might be trans! My suggestion is to look up different trans identities and see if any of them describe you.

(For clarification, you do NOT need gender dysphoria to be trans, and you do NOT have to medically transition to be trans. Those are just things that a lot of trans people experience and/or go through, so I thought I'd bring them up)
